本文整理汇总了C++中Profiler::push_call方法的典型用法代码示例。如果您正苦于以下问题:C++ Profiler::push_call方法的具体用法?C++ Profiler::push_call怎么用?C++ Profiler::push_call使用的例子?那么,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类Profiler
的用法示例。
在下文中一共展示了Profiler::push_call方法的1个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的C++代码示例。
示例1: push_call
void Program::push_call(PlainId fn_name, term_v ¶ms)
{
if (tracing_enabled)
program_profiler.push_call(fn_name);
if (stack.size() > 200)
{
cout << "Stack overflow!\n";
print_stack();
halt;
}
stack.push_back(StackEntry(fn_name, params));
}